Fosfowok 4gm Injection
Uses:
- Treatment of uncomplicated urinary tract infections (UTIs), particularly caused by susceptible bacteria.
- Prevention of possible infections before prostate surgical procedures in adult men.
Therapeutic Effects:
- Inhibits the synthesis of bacterial cell walls, leading to the death of susceptible bacteria.

Side Effects:
- Serious: sudden onset of itching, rash or hives on the skin, shortness of breath and wheezing, swelling of the face, lips, tongue or throat, moderate to severe abdominal cramps, bloody stools, fever.
- Common: headache, dizziness, diarrhea, nausea, indigestion, abdominal pain, infection of the female genital organs.

FAQs:
What infections does Fosfowok 4gm Injection treat? Fosfowok 4gm Injection is primarily used to treat uncomplicated urinary tract infections (UTIs) caused by certain susceptible bacteria, particularly Escherichia coli (E. coli).
How is Fosfowok 4gm Injection administered? Fosfowok 4gm Injection is available in several forms, including oral granules, sachets, and intravenous (IV) preparations. For uncomplicated UTIs, it is often given as a single oral dose. A course of IV treatment may be prescribed for more severe or complicated infections.
Can Fosfowok 4gm Injection be used to prevent UTIs? Fosfowok 4gm Injection is primarily used for the treatment of UTIs, not for prevention.
Is Fosfowok 4gm Injection effective against antibiotic-resistant bacteria? Fosfowok 4gm Injection can still be effective against some antibiotic-resistant bacteria, including certain strains of multidrug-resistant E. coli. However, susceptibility testing is necessary to determine if the specific bacterial strain causing the infection is susceptible to this drug.

Fact Box:
- Molecule name: Fosfomycin
- Therapeutic class: Urinary anti-infectives
- Pharmacological class: Phosphonic antibiotics
- Indications: Treat uncomplicated urinary tract infections (UTIs)
